Sara Watro poured in five goals and Anna Maria Warrington added four strikes to lead Methacton to a 19-2 Pioneer Athletic Conference girls lacrosse romp over Pope John Paul II Friday afternoon.
The Warriors (6-1 overall) remained perfect in five PAC-10 starts while PJP fell to 0-5.
Boyertown 15, Phoenixville 0
The seven-time defending PAC-10 champions bolted out to a 12-0 lead by intermission and never looked back in routing the Phantoms. Kelly Furman’s hat trick sparked a balanced effort that saw 10 Bears (6-0 Liberty, 6-3 overall) find the back of the net.
Karen Hayde came up with 14 saves for Phoenixville (3-3 Frontier, 3-5 overall).
Owen J. Roberts 18, Pottsgrove 4
The Wildcats (2-5 Liberty, 2-7) rode Devin Hassinger’s six goals and Emily Kolsevich’s four strikes to the easy PAC-10 triumph over the Falcons. OJR also got two goals apiece from Madison Bedell, Kelsey Dielman, Devan Davis and Whitney Wilkinson.
Pottsgrove (1-4 Frontier, 2-5) was led by Rachelle Mewshaw’s two goals and single tallies from Cirri Watson and Rebecca Dolenti.
Upper Perkiomen 12, Perkiomen Valley 6
The Indians moved to .500 at 4-4 as Leah High produced a hat trick, countering three goals from Alexa Webb of Perkiomen Valley (1-5 Liberty, 2-6).
Spring-Ford 12, Springfield-Montco 11
The Rams (6-3 overall, 4-2 Liberty) scored the non-league decision behind hat tricks from Maddie Ward and Leanne Shaw.
Libby Field poured in six goals for the Spartans and Anna Studenmund added three more.
Henderson 20, Pottstown 7
Katelyn Fay pumped in eight goals and Kalie O’Donnell added six goals and two assists to help the Warriors deal the Trojans a non-league defeat.
Milan White found the range for five goals and Morgan Wambold delivered 14 saves for Pottstown (4-6).
